getting

/ˈɡɛtɪŋ/

verbnounget · ting

Think: “GET + -ING” — you’re GETting by adding -ing to get.

Yes, it's getting. Keep the base word GET, then add -ing: get + ting (no extra letters).

Definitions

  1. verbPresent participle of get; coming to have, receive, obtain, or become something.
  2. verbBecoming or growing (used to show a change over time), as in “getting better.”
  3. nounInformal: earnings or profits; what someone gets (often plural: “gettings”).

Examples

  • I’m getting ready for school.
  • She is getting better at spelling each week.
  • We’re getting a new puppy this weekend.
